Panjim Basketeers, YMCA Infiknights crowned champions

Team Herald
PANJIM: Panjim Basketeers and YMCA Infiknights were crowned the men’s and women’s champions respectively of the Summer Slam Basketball tournament organised by YMCA Titans under the aegis of Goa Basketball Association, at Don Bosco Oratory, Panjim, recently. 
In a thrilling gold medal game against YMCA Titans, Panjim Basketeers won their first title in Senior Men’s team category with an exciting 57 -53 win over the hosts.   
Panjim Basketeers seemed to be cruising to a comfortable win and at one point of time were leading by 13 points till a few minutes into the third quarter but some inspired play from the young Titans squad brought the hosts back in the game. 
 The last few minutes of the 3rd quarter saw a complete change of momentum for the Titans team as their big 3, Stefan De Souza, Abelio De Souza and Jaedan Vaz, played brilliantly to keep their team in the hunt and bring down the deficit to 4 points at the end of the third quarter.
The beginning of the 4th quarter saw a complete turn of events as the Titans squad surprised everyone with a brilliant comeback. 
With the crowd behind them, the hosts managed to reverse the fortunes and went into a four point lead, with barely 2 minutes remaining on the final buzzer. But the Panjim Basketeers team managed to keep their composure in the final moments of the match with some excellent team play in defence followed by fast attacks to close out an exciting win. 
Team captain Bharat Patil, former India player who was selected for the UBA league, had an excellent outing, scoring 20 points to lead his team from the front. The shooting guard combined well with team dribbler, Omkar Chopade. Bharat with his controlled play and clinical finishes and Omkar with his quick bursts of speed starred for the winning team. The two gelled extremely well to help their team emerge as best in the championship. Omkar netted 14 points while Sahil Karale, who was the pick of the players in previous games, provided decent support contributing 12 points. 
For YMCA Titans, their young stars, Stefan De Souza (22 points), Abelio De Souza (12 points) and Jaedan Vaz (10 points) fought hard. Stefan De Souza in fact was magnificent in the final. 
The top scorer throughout the tournament kept on finishing some difficult fast-break layups and impressed with his speed and fine runs to be adjudged the most valuable player-of-the-tournament. Jaedan Vaz won emerging player-of-the-tournament prize while Karl Menezes won the 3 point shooting contest.
In Women’s Team championship final which was equally well contested, YMCA Infiknights edged out DBO Lynx 29 -24. The game was an edge-of-the-seat affair with fortunes fluctuating by the quarter. The first quarter saw the Infiknights team get into a healthy 16 -5 lead. 
The next two quarters went the DBO Lynx way, who led 23 – 21 at the end of the third quarter. However, the Infiknights team bounced back in the fourth quarter, with controlled aggression and a cohesive defensive approach to emerge well deserved champions.  
For the winning team, Rachel Raposa fired a game-high 11 points, while Rose Rhea Rebello netted 10 points and Michelle Noronha scoring 4 points. Saachia Nathan (8 points), Shimoi Nathan (7 points) and Uma Gokhale (5 points) waged a fighting battle in a losing cause for the runner up team.
